A sonometer wire with a suspended mass of M=1 kg is in resononce with a given tuning fork. The apparatus is taken to the moon where the acceleration due to gravity is `1//6^(th)` that on earth. To obtain resonance on the moon, the value of M should be

A

`1kg`

B

`sqrt(6)kg`

C

`6kg`

D

`36kg`

Text Solution

Verified by Experts

The correct Answer is:
C

`n=(1)/(2l)sqrt((T)/(mu))` To get resonance with same fork
`impliesT=Mg=` const `impliesM_(2)g_(2)=M_(1)g_(1)`
